Released in 1979. A masterpiece album by Rainbow.

The powerful voice of new vocalist Graham Bonnet is a must-listen.

Vocalist Ronnie James Dio left the band. Graham Bonnet joined the band, and this work marked a major change in direction. "Since You Been Gone" is a rare pop song. It was the band's first single to enter the top 10 of the UK singles chart (peaking at number 6). Produced by former Deep Purple member Roger Glover, who also participated as a bassist.
